Pricing Breakdown
HubSpot
Free: unlimited contacts, deal tracking, email templates, meeting links, live chat. Starter: $20/month (remove branding). Professional: $890/month/Marketing Hub (full automation). Enterprise: $3,600/month.
Zendesk
Suite Team: $55/agent/month. Growth: $89/agent/month. Professional: $115/agent/month. Enterprise: $169/agent/month. No free tier.

Editorial Verdict
HubSpot takes the lead for solo founders — it offers better value and is explicitly solo-friendly. Zendesk may still be the right pick if you need deep Customer Support features or plan to scale to a larger team.
